2. Walk-In Closet Layouts: Choosing the Right Design

Selecting the right layout for your walk-in closet depends on available space, storage needs, and personal preferences. Here are some of the most popular walk-in closet designs to consider:

2.1 U-Shaped Walk-In Closet

A U-shaped closet is ideal for those who need maximum storage space. This design utilizes three walls, providing ample room for hanging rods, shelves, drawers, and a dressing area.

Best For: Large master bedrooms
Features: Custom shelving, central seating, and layered lighting

2.2 L-Shaped Walk-In Closet

An L-shaped walk-in closet is a space-efficient solution that maximizes two walls while leaving the rest of the closet open for movement.

Best For: Medium-sized spaces
Features: Hanging rods on one side, shelving on the other, and built-in shoe storage

2.3 Straight Walk-In Closet (Single-Wall Layout)

A single-wall closet is a simple yet highly effective solution for small spaces. This layout works well with sliding closet doors and mirrored panels to create an open feel.

Best For: Small bedrooms or compact spaces
Features: Vertical shelving, minimal hanging rods, and hidden compartments

2.4 Island Walk-In Closet

For those who want a luxurious, boutique-style closet, an island layout is the ultimate choice. The island can serve as a storage solution and a dressing table for added functionality.

Best For: Spacious master closets
Features: Custom cabinetry, a central storage island, and stylish lighting fixtures

Planning Your Small Bathroom Remodel

Assessing Your Current Space

Before you start any renovation, it’s essential to evaluate the existing layout and features of your bathroom. Ask yourself:

 

    • Does my current layout maximize space?

    • Are there any outdated elements that need to be replaced?

    • Am I utilizing all available storage efficiently?

    • What are the key pain points (poor lighting, lack of storage, old fixtures, etc.)?

Understanding what works and what doesn’t will help you prioritize your remodel goals.

Setting a Budget

A small bathroom remodel can range from a simple refresh to a complete transformation, and the budget should reflect the scope of the project. Here’s a breakdown of estimated costs:

 

    • Basic Update: $2,000 – $5,000 (painting, minor fixture upgrades, and decor changes)

    • Mid-Range Remodel: $6,000 – $15,000 (new tiles, vanity, fixtures, and layout modifications)

    • Luxury Remodel: $15,000+ (high-end materials, custom cabinetry, premium fixtures, and design changes)

Having a clear budget helps prevent overspending and ensures you allocate funds efficiently.

The Remodeling Process: Step-by-Step Guide

1. Demolition and Preparation

 

    • Remove old fixtures, tiles, and flooring.

    • Check plumbing and electrical systems for necessary updates.

    • Ensure proper ventilation to prevent mold and mildew.

2. Structural and Plumbing Work

 

    • Update old pipes and fixtures if needed.

    • Install new plumbing elements like a walk-in shower or wall-mounted toilet.

    • Ensure waterproofing in wet areas.

3. Installing Flooring and Walls

 

    • Lay down new floor tiles with proper sealing.

    • Install wall tiles or waterproof wallpaper for a fresh look.

    • Consider heated flooring for extra comfort.

4. Installing Fixtures and Cabinetry

 

    • Mount vanities, medicine cabinets, and mirrors.

    • Install new faucets, showerheads, and lighting fixtures.

    • Add final touches like towel bars and hooks.

5. Final Touches and Decor

 

    • Choose soft furnishings like bath mats, towels, and shower curtains.

    • Add greenery with small potted plants.

    • Incorporate stylish accessories like soap dispensers and artwork.

Common Mistakes to Avoid in a Small Bathroom Remodel

1. Neglecting Ventilation

Poor ventilation leads to mold and mildew issues. Install an exhaust fan to keep air circulating.

2. Overlooking Storage

Failing to plan for storage can result in cluttered countertops. Use smart storage solutions.

3. Ignoring Lighting

A dimly lit bathroom can feel cramped. Use layered lighting with ceiling, wall, and task lighting.

4. Choosing the Wrong Materials

Avoid porous tiles and countertops that stain easily. Opt for durable, water-resistant materials.

5. Skipping Professional Help When Needed

DIY is great, but some tasks require experts. Plumbing, electrical work, and structural changes should be handled by professionals.
